The most basic of all car electronics is the car alarm. The proper car alarm will be able to ward off attackers who would want to do damage or steal items in the car or even the car itself. To protect against such tragedy, car owners should always obtain a car alarm first. Even if one doesn't have the best looking car of them all, even a sub-par vehicle is quite costly should it be stolen.



It's tough to conclude if the DVD player present in cars today is too distracting or worth the trouble in obtaining. For drivers, there is obviously not much to gain. But for passengers and small children, there is no better way to keep passengers entertained than to invest in a DVD player. The only point to worry about is the fact that drivers may become distracted from such items.



Avoiding an accident, such as in the case of the car alarm, is important for car owners. Although it wouldn't seem to handy at first, the HID lighting systems available today are almost necessary for those driving in rural areas. These HID lights are brighter, cleaner, and more efficient- meaning they will be better in avoiding animals and pedestrians. They also look great compared to traditional lights- which gives credit to one's reputation.



GPS devices are also very popular on the car electronics market. After all, there is nothing worse than getting lost while on a vacation or on the way to a certain location. If one lives in the city, it's almost a mandatory purchase. Otherwise, it's great to have around so that missing a turn or even finding shortcuts is possible. And thanks to 3D technology, the whole process can be viewed in interesting perspectives.



Lastly, electronic air horns are all the rage in the customization scene. It is genuinely unique to have air horns fixed to one's hood. Although this look isn't for everyone, it certainly brings out nice features in bigger vehicles such as an SUV or truck. Some large cars, like the Cadillac, also do well with being fixed with such a horn.
